(B) Definition.
"PARIS" is a system for matching data with select federal and state agencies
for the purpose of determining medicaid or other public assistance eligibility.
PARIS provides information regarding federal wages, veterans administration
benefits, and duplicate benefits received in two or more states.
(C) Administrative agency responsibilities.
(1) Review and compare against the case
record all information received to determine whether it affects the
individual's eligibility.
